Output 81e0c91379cfdcc4b83a1179cf6fa766c31cb7398c24fc19f65aec7bd9f3e546:198

value
6184
script pubkey
OP_0 OP_PUSHBYTES_20 d817f3c9474bf8586dcb709be8514d379e2f3c16
address
bc1qmqtl8j28f0u9smwtwzd7s52dx70z70qk03ggwh
transaction
81e0c91379cfdcc4b83a1179cf6fa766c31cb7398c24fc19f65aec7bd9f3e546
confirmations
212488
spent
true